A rare suspense masterpiece.

The first half of the film is a little sluggish, but some content still plays a key role in the conflict that follows. In the second half, the rhythm is fast, and the soundtrack is a bit overwhelming, but it's easy to make people feel nervous. I think some lines in the film (preferably compared to English lines) and the text shots of some manuscript letters in the film are quite important.

The tone of the whole film is very dark, and there are many before and after shots, which are very interesting in retrospect. I like the design of the ending the most. It is said to have subverted the original book. It is a very Polanski ending, which is very meaningful.

A few understandings about the plot (there are spoilers, be careful)

1. Mike, the first writer, I think was framed on the ferry, because the ghost saw choppy water on the ferry twice. (Of course it doesn't matter how Mike died)

2. Regarding the murderer who killed Lang, I think this person is the CIA. Because at the tavern he knew very well that the ghost was working for the lang, and that night the ghost's room was searched. Furthermore, as a demonstrator whose son has died, he is too calm, he is just making an excuse for himself to be with the demonstrators and to monitor Lang in order to find an opportunity to attack.

3. The one-night stand between ruth and ghost is not for reading the script, but this does not mean that the scene is superfluous. First of all, Ruth's wonderful performance made Ghost doubt Lang's character, which laid the foundation for Ghost to easily identify Lang as a spy. Second, ruth is actually using ghost's words to see if he can see any clues from the manuscript.

4. I think it is not the foreign minister who is tracking the ghost at Paul's house, but the CIA. They are not trying to grab the manuscript, but want to kill the ghost at any time.
